Datavault AI Inc. (NASDAQ: DVLT) has successfully closed the initial tranche of its previously announced $150 million Bitcoin investment from Scilex Holding Company (NASDAQ: SCLX). This strategic financial move represents a significant milestone for the AI-driven data visualization company, providing substantial capital to advance its technological initiatives in the rapidly evolving Web 3.0 landscape. The transaction involved Scilex receiving 15,000,000 shares of Datavault common stock at an effective purchase price of $0.5378 per share, establishing a strong financial foundation for Datavault's continued growth and innovation.
The remaining balance of the $150 million investment will be issued through a second tranche via a pre-funded warrant, subject to Datavault stockholder approval for the issuance of shares exceeding 19.99% of pre-financing shares outstanding. Datavault AI operates as a leader in AI-driven data visualization, valuation, and monetization, with its cloud-based platform serving multiple industries through its Acoustic Science and Data Science Divisions. The company's Acoustic Science Division features patented technologies including WiSA, ADIO, and Sumerian, which represent industry-first foundational spatial and multichannel wireless HD sound transmission technologies. These innovations cover intellectual property related to audio timing, synchronization, and multi-channel interference cancellation, positioning Datavault at the forefront of acoustic technology development.
The Data Science Division leverages Web 3.0 capabilities and high-performance computing to provide solutions for experiential data perception, valuation, and secure monetization. This division's technology serves diverse sectors including sports & entertainment, events & venues, biotech, education, fintech, real estate, healthcare, and energy. The company's Information Data Exchange enables Digital Twins and facilitates the licensing of name, image, and likeness by securely attaching physical real-world objects to immutable metadata objects, fostering responsible AI implementation with integrity.
